Abstract :
Formation of potassium cyanide clusters in the direct laser vaporization of K3[Fe(CN)6] was studied by use of a TOF mass spectrometer. It was found that the positive cluster ions are due to [K(KCN)n]+, n = 0–37, in which magic numbers are n = 4, 13, 22, 37, whereas the negative cluster ions were assigned to [(KCN)nCN]−, n = 0–13, where magic numbers are n = 4, 13. These magic numbers are identical with those of alkali-halide clusters. This indicates that they have the structures 1 × 3 × 3 (n = 4), 3 × 3 × 3 (n = 13), 3 × 3 × 5 (n = 22), 3 × 5 × 5 (n = 37) as those of alkali-halide clusters. Thus the formation process of potassium cyanide clusters should go along the growth course of the rock salt structure.
